What is Terex's SV — goodwill, gross?
Terex (TEX) reported SV — goodwill, gross of $1.45B in Q1 2026.
What does SV — goodwill, gross mean?
Represents the total premium paid over the fair value of net assets during acquisitions attributed to the Specialty Vehicles segment. It reflects the historical cost of intangible benefits like brand value and synergies acquired through past business combinations.
